How to Make Artichoke Salad

Quick Overview

Artichoke Salad is incredibly easy to prepare, taking only about 10 minutes from start to finish. The textures are wonderfully crunchy, the flavors are vibrant, and every bite is a treat for your taste buds. Whether you’re hosting a gathering or simply craving a fresh side, you can’t go wrong with this refreshingly simple recipe.

Ingredients

  • 1 can of artichoke hearts, drained and chopped
  • 1 cup of c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1/4 cup of diced red onion
  • 1/4 cup of feta cheese, crumbled
  • 2 tablespoons of ol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on of lemon juice
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ish

Make sure to drain the artichoke hearts well; this will keep your salad from becoming too soggy.

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Prepare Your Ingredients: Start by draining the can of artichoke hearts and chopping them into bite-size pieces. Halve the cherry tomatoes and dice up the red onion—these will add great texture and flavor.
  2. Combine the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the chopped artichoke hearts, halved cherry tomatoes, diced red onion, and crumbled feta cheese.
  3. Dress the Salad: In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Pour the dressing over your salad mix.
  4. Toss and Serve: Gently toss all the ingredients together until they are well coated with the dressing. Garnish with freshly chopped parsley for a pop of color and flavor.
  5. Enjoy: Your Artichoke Salad is now ready to be served! It pairs beautifully with grilled meats or can stand alone as a light lunch.

Top Tips for Perfecting Artichoke Salad

  • Substitutions: If you’re not a fan of feta cheese, try goat cheese or omit it altogether for a dairy-free version. You can also swap the cherry tomatoes for diced bell peppers for a different flavor profile.
  • Freshness Matters: Make sure to use fresh ingredients whenever possible for the best taste. Opt for ripe cherry tomatoes and high-quality olive oil.
  • Timing is Key: If you can, let the salad sit for about 10 minutes after mixing. This allows the flavors to meld together beautifully.
  • Avoiding Mistakes: Take care not to over-mix the salad, as this can break down the delicate artichoke hearts and tomatoes, leading to a mushy salad.

Storing and Reheating Tips

Artichoke Salad is best enjoyed fresh, but you can store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days. When storing, it’s a good idea to keep the dressing separate until you’re ready to eat it again to maintain the salad’s freshness and texture. FAQ

  1. Can I make this Artichoke Salad a day ahead?
    Yes! You can prepare all the ingredients the day before and store them separately. Combine them right before serving for the best flavor and texture.
  2. Is this recipe gluten-free?
    Absolutely! All the ingredients in this Artichoke Salad are naturally gluten-free, making it a safe choice for those with gluten intolerance.
  3. Can I add protein to this salad?
    Certainly! Grilled chicken, chickpeas, or even shrimp can elevate this salad into a fulfilling main dish.
  4. What can I serve this salad with?
    This salad pairs wonderfully with grilled chicken, lamb, or a hearty soup. It’s also delightful alongside grains like quinoa or couscous.
